44-46 Performing Setup from the Control Panel Proxy Port Number Proxy Port Number 0-65535 [0] Enter the proxy port number assigned to PrintMe Services. In addition, some proxy servers require a user name and password for access. If the proxy server in your environment has such requirements, you must configure PrintMe services with a valid user name and password to use when accessing the proxy server. Some Microsoft proxy servers also require that you specify the Windows domain for which the user name and password are valid. Proxy Server Domain Proxy Server Domain Enter the name of the proper domain for use with the proxy server. Proxy User Name Proxy User Name Enter the user name for use with the proxy server. Proxy Password Proxy Password Enter the password for use with the proxy server. Verify New Password Reenter the password assigned to the proxy server. Save Changes Yes/No [Yes] Select Yes to activate any changes made in PrintMe Setup; select No to return to the main Setup menu without making any changes.
